Saudi Royal Air Force plane crashes in Middle East – all crew killed

Defence Ministry sources said investigations were underway to determine the cause of the crash.

He did not reveal how many crew members were aboard the British-made Hawk jet when it came down in the north of the kingdom.

The BAE Systems Hawk is a single-engine, jet-powered advanced trainer aircraft best know for its appearances in the famous Red Arrows display team.
